4.2 Configuring the PenMount Windows

XP/2003/Vista/7 Driver

Upon rebooting, the computer automatically finds the new PenMount 9036 RS232
interface controller board or PenMount 6300 USB interface controller board. The
touch screen is connected but not calibrated. Follow the procedures below to carry
out calibration.
1. After installation, click the PenMount Monitor icon “PM” in the menu bar.
2. When the PenMount Control Panel appears, click “Calibrate”.

PenMount Control Panel

The functions of the PenMount Control Panel are Calibrate, Multiple Monitors, Tools,
and About, which are explained in the following sections.

Device

In this window, you can find out that how many devices are detected on your
system.

Calibrate

This function offers two ways to calibrate your touch screen. “Standard Calibration”

adjusts most touch screens. “Advanced Calibration” adjusts aging touch screens.
